Overview

MVR5510AVMANEP from NXP Semiconductors is an industrial-grade multi-output power management IC (PMIC) integrating six voltage rails: three synchronous buck converters (BUCK1–BUCK3), one high-voltage synchronous buck controller (VPRE), one boost converter, and three LDOs plus a high-voltage LDO (HVLDO). It delivers up to 10 A via external MOSFETs on VPRE, supports 60 VDC max input, and operates across –40 °C to +105 °C for industrial domain controllers and S32G3-based DDR3L systems.

Technical Context

The MVR5510AVMANEP implements dual independent state machines: a Main state machine managing power-up sequencing, standby/deep-sleep transitions, and regulator enable/disable timing; and a Fail-Safe (FS) state machine monitoring critical faults (e.g., overvoltage on VPRE_FB, thermal shutdown), asserting FS0B, and enforcing deterministic reset behavior. Power sequencing is fully configurable via one-time programmable (OTP) registers, including slot-based startup order and VPRE_OFF_DLY_OTP delay (250 µs or 32 ms) for external PMIC coordination.

It supports industrial qualification (AEC-Q100 Grade 1, MSL3), operates with 35 µA standby current (VPRE + HVLDO active), and integrates EMC optimization features including SMPS frequency synchronization (FIN/FOUT), spread spectrum modulation, slew rate control, and manual frequency tuning - all confirmed for conducted emissions/immunity per IEC 61967-4 and IEC 62132-4 at 12-M and 10-K levels.

Pinout & Package

Package: 8 mm × 8 mm, 56-pin QFN-EP (exposed pad), MSL3, RoHS-compliant. Pin layout follows JEDEC MO-220 standard with step-cut wettable flank for EP suffix parts (e.g., MVR5510AVMANEP).

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
PWRON1 / PWRON2Power Enable InputsAsynchronous wake-up triggers; PWRON1 initiates full power-up, PWRON2 enables Deep Sleep entry
STBYStandby Control InputToggles between Normal_M and Standby modes; requires coordinated I²C command for safe rail discharge
PGOOD / RSTB / FS0BPower Status OutputsPGOOD indicates all rails in regulation; RSTB resets MCU; FS0B is open-drain fail-safe output (active low)
VDDIODigital Interface Supply1.75–3.4 V supply for I²C, INTB, FIN/FOUT; decoupling mandatory
VCOREMONCore Voltage Monitor InputMust connect to BUCK1 output (or BUCK1/2 dual-phase node) for accurate SVS/DVS feedback
PRE_SW / PRE_GHS / PRE_GLSVPRE Controller TerminalsSwitching node, high-side gate drive, low-side gate drive - interface to external MOSFETs for 10 A capability
BUCK1_IN / BUCK1_SW / BUCK1_FBCore Buck Converter InterfaceInput supply, switching node, and feedback path for MCU core rail (dual-phase capable up to 7.2 A peak)
LDO1_IN / LDO1 / LDO2_IN / LDO2 / LDO3_IN / LDO3Linear Regulator I/OThree independent LDOs supporting configurable voltages for MCU I/O, DDR, and ADC supplies (up to 400 mA each)
HV_HVLDO_IN / HVLDO / LV_HVLDO_INHigh-Voltage LDO InterfaceSupports 10 mA LDO mode or 100 mA switch-mode operation; dual-input architecture enables flexible sourcing
FCCU1/WDI / FCCU2Fault Collection Unit InputsConnect to MCU fault-reporting pins; enables watchdog windowing and fail-safe escalation per ISO 26262 QM flow

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Configurable Power-Up SequencingOTP-programmable slot-based startup order ensures safe ramp-up of S32G3 core, DDR3L, and I/O rails without voltage back-feeding
Fail-Safe State MachineDedicated hardware FSM monitors VPRE_FB, thermal events, and MCU watchdog signals - asserts FS0B within <1 µs on fault detection
EMC-Optimized SwitchingFrequency synchronization (FIN/FOUT), spread spectrum, and slew rate control reduce peak EMI by >10 dB in 150 kHz–30 MHz band
Low-Power Industrial Operation35 µA standby current with VPRE + HVLDO active enables always-on wake-up capability in battery-backed industrial gateways
I²C with CRC Protection3.4 MHz interface with cyclic redundancy check prevents register corruption during noisy automotive/industrial bus conditions
VPRE External Buck ControllerDrives external high-side/low-side MOSFETs to deliver up to 10 A at 60 V input - eliminates need for discrete HV buck stage

FAQ

What safety level does the MVR5510AVMANEP support?

The MVR5510AVMANEP is configured in QM (Quality Management) mode per its MAN OTP programming. It does not activate ASIL B or ASIL D monitoring circuitry, fail-safe state machine escalation paths, or dedicated FCCU interfaces - making it suitable for industrial applications where ISO 26262 functional safety certification is not required. All safety-related registers remain disabled in this configuration.

Does the MVR5510AVMANEP support DDR3L memory power sequencing?

Yes, the MVR5510AVMANEP supports DDR3L power sequencing through OTP-configurable startup slots. BUCK3 is typically assigned to the DDR3L VDDQ rail, while LDO2 supplies VDDIO and LDO3 handles termination voltage (VTT). The sequencing order, delay times, and enable/disable timing are fully programmable via I²C or one-time OTP programming to match JEDEC DDR3L specification requirements.

What is the purpose of the PSYNC pin on the MVR5510AVMANEP?

The PSYNC pin on the MVR5510AVMANEP enables synchronized switching between two devices to reduce system-level EMI. When configured via OTP, it operates as either an input (to lock switching frequency to an external master) or output (to drive a slave device). This feature is confirmed in the datasheet for dual-PMIC configurations in S32G3 domain controllers requiring phase-aligned BUCK1 outputs.

Can the MVR5510AVMANEP operate with a 48 V input supply?

Yes, the MVR5510AVMANEP is validated for 48 V input at room temperature for up to 15 minutes to meet jump-start requirements in 24 V industrial systems. Its VSUP1/2 pins tolerate up to +60 V DC continuously, and it sustains 58 V load dump events without external protection - confirmed in Section 8.3 of the datasheet under "Operating voltage range" and maximum ratings.

How is the VPRE controller configured for 10 A output on the MVR5510AVMANEP?

The VPRE controller on the MVR5510AVMANEP drives external high-side and low-side MOSFETs via PRE_GHS, PRE_GLS, and PRE_SW pins. Output current capability reaches 10 A through selection of appropriate external FETs and inductor, with current limit set via PRE_CSP and PRE_COMP network. Configuration is performed via OTP programming of VPRE-specific registers, and operation is confirmed in Section 28.4.2 ("VPRE") of the datasheet.
